Вопросы по теме 'xml-serialization'

Сериализация DateTime по времени без миллисекунд и gmt
Я создал файл класса C #, используя XSD-файл в качестве входных данных. Одно из моих свойств выглядит так: private System.DateTime timeField; [System.Xml.Serialization.XmlElementAttribute(DataType="time")] public System.DateTime Time {...
16946 просмотров
schedule 30.09.2023

Как десериализовать XML-файл в класс со свойством только для чтения?
У меня есть класс, который я использую как класс настроек, сериализованный в XML-файл, который администраторы могут затем редактировать, чтобы изменить настройки в приложении. (Настройки немного сложнее, чем позволяет App.config .) Я использую...
3445 просмотров
schedule 06.10.2022

Рекомендации по загрузке объекта из сериализованного XML в C#
Привет, У меня есть конкретный объект, который может быть создан из файла как таковой: public class ConfigObj { public ConfigObj(string loadPath) { //load object using .Net's supplied Serialization library...
1982 просмотров
schedule 28.08.2023

Как сериализовать в dateTime
Работаем над получением DateTimes для любого часового пояса. Я использую DateTimeOffset, строку и атрибут XmlElement. Когда я это сделаю, я получаю следующую ошибку: [InvalidOperationException: dateTime - недопустимое значение для свойства...
59753 просмотров
schedule 04.02.2022

Как я могу использовать интерфейс IEnumerable и в то же время сделать так, чтобы XMLSerializer не использовал GetEnumerator()?
У меня есть класс, который анализирует очень большой файл (который не помещается в памяти), и в настоящее время я использую интерфейс IEnumerable для использования foreach, поэтому я могу легко получить проанализированное содержимое файла построчно....
538 просмотров
schedule 09.09.2023

создать XmlSerializer в MFC C++
Я хочу реализовать в своем проекте приложения MFC эту логику, написанную на С#, которая выглядит так: XmlSerializer ser = new XmlSerializer(typeof(A_CLASS)); StringBuilder sb = new StringBuilder(); XmlWriterSettings sett = new...
1100 просмотров
schedule 11.11.2022

Коллекция XmlSerialization как массив
Я пытаюсь сериализовать настраиваемый класс, который должен использовать несколько элементов с одним и тем же именем. Я пробовал использовать xmlarray, но он помещает их в другие элементы. Я хочу, чтобы мой xml выглядел так. <root>...
2386 просмотров
schedule 12.06.2022

Десериализация XML и свободные элементы массива
Итак, я работаю с некоторыми файлами XML, которые, по моему мнению, скорее всего плохо сформированы, и пытаюсь выяснить, как и можно ли использовать XmlSerializer для десериализации этого XML в логический бизнес-объект. Допустим, у меня есть...
3429 просмотров
schedule 20.11.2023

Как настроить сериализацию WCF XML
У нас есть существующий интерфейс веб-службы SOAP, который мы хотим реализовать с помощью WCF для нового приложения. Кажется, все работает нормально, за исключением одной маленькой детали. Пространство имен XML возвращаемого типа функции должно...
20680 просмотров
schedule 11.02.2022

Сериализация XML - отсутствует префикс пространства имен на стороне клиента
Я создал веб-службу .NET, которая возвращает объект, скажем, класс "getResponse". WS возвращает следующий ответ... <getResponse xmlns="http://tempuri.org/getCustomer/wsdl/"> <Result xmlns="http://tempuri.org/getCustomer/">...
8904 просмотров

Как сериализовать объект в XDocument?
У меня есть класс, отмеченный атрибутами DataContract, и я хотел бы создать XDocument из объектов этого класса. Как лучше всего это сделать? Я могу сделать это, пройдя через XmlDocument , но это кажется ненужным шагом.
22207 просмотров
schedule 03.11.2022

Сериализация XML без удаления
using (var file_stream = File.Create("users.xml")) { var serializer = new XmlSerializer(typeof(PasswordManager)); serializer.Serialize(file_stream, this); file_stream.Close(); }...
4665 просмотров
schedule 13.11.2022

Исключение XStream fromXML()
Я пытаюсь десериализовать строку в Java с помощью пакета XStream. Пакет XStream может нормально сериализовать мой класс. Я получаю XML (не могу изменить формат XML) с сервера и пытаюсь сохранить информацию об узле в соответствующих переменных в...
34891 просмотров
schedule 15.12.2022

Могу ли я сделать так, чтобы редактор коллекции по умолчанию и/или пользовательский UIEditor вызывали метод доступа set для свойства?
Я пишу подключаемый модуль для приложения, в котором у меня есть собственный класс, который атрибутирует собственные объекты программы. API позволяет мне читать и записывать строки с ключами непосредственно в объекты в собственном файле и из них....
892 просмотров

XML complexType с элементом, который заканчивается как XmlElement
В моем XSD у меня есть что-то похожее на это: <?xml version="1.0" encoding="utf-8" ?> <schema xmlns:jump="testThingy" elementFormDefault="qualified" targetNamespace="testThingy" xmlns="http://www.w3.org/2001/XMLSchema"> <element...
985 просмотров
schedule 06.12.2022

Кодирование специальных символов в xml
Как кодировать специальные символы в xml? например: у меня есть специальный символ mu в моем xml, преобразование не удастся из-за этого символа, любая информация будет полезна Спасибо, Притам.
8025 просмотров
schedule 01.02.2024

Получение сериализации XML для автоматического игнорирования несериализуемых свойств
Я использую классы сериализации .NET для сериализации XML и регистрации значений аргументов, которые передаются определенным функциям в моем приложении. Для этого мне нужны средства для XML-сериализации значений свойств любых классов, которые...
1954 просмотров
schedule 21.11.2022

Как игнорировать атрибут [XMLIgnore]
Я пытаюсь сериализовать некоторые объекты, полученные из сторонней библиотеки .NET Lib, в файл XML. Когда я Go To Definition для объекта, некоторые из свойств этого объекта помечаются как [XMLIgnore] Есть ли способ сказать моему...
32568 просмотров
schedule 13.04.2022

При отражении: следует установить свойство или напрямую установить значение? (Цель-С)
Я пишу класс сериализации xml для target-c. Суть в том, чтобы дать классу тип класса и файл xml. Он должен вернуть экземпляр с данными. У меня он работает, и он делает совсем немного - обрабатывает примитивы (+nsstring), определяемые пользователем...
4428 просмотров

XmlSerializer , base64 кодирует элемент String
Рассмотрим простой случай public class Test { public String myString; } Могу ли я каким-либо образом сказать XmlSerializer, чтобы base64 кодировал myString при сериализации?
6707 просмотров
schedule 18.05.2022